Angra dos Reis is a stunning coastal paradise located in the state of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. Known for its breathtaking natural beauty, it boasts over 365 islands with crystal-clear waters, lush Atlantic Forest, and pristine beaches. The region is a favorite destination for boat tours, snorkeling, and diving enthusiasts who come to explore vibrant marine life and underwater landscapes. Angra dos Reis is recognized as one of the best diving spots in Brazil. Its clear, calm waters offer excellent visibility, revealing the rich local aquatic fauna and flora. Diving activities are conducted by a certified PADI company, with daily departures aboard vessels specially equipped for diving. Dive sites vary and are confirmed on the day of the tour based on visibility and tide conditions. This ensures the best possible experience for divers of all levels. - Activity shared with other passengers. In the first thirty minutes, general instructions are given on how to dive. Then, after a wetsuit fitting, the divers will board the boat to Angra Bay. For beginners, there is 1 diving spot and for those already certified, there are 2 different diving spots. Water, seasonal fruit and a light snack are provided on the boat. The operator provides wetsuits, fins and a tank, so when booking, the shoe size, height and weight of the people who will be taking part in the activity will be requested.
